Equipment and process
Different surfaces need different tools. Soft washing uses low pressure combined with the right cleaning solution to lift dirt, algae and mildew from siding without stripping paint or damaging softer materials. Pressure washing uses higher pressure suited to concrete, brick and other hard surfaces that can handle it. Window cleaning relies on proper squeegee technique and the right solution to leave glass streak-free rather than just wet and drying unevenly. Gutter cleaning means physically clearing debris from the trough and downspouts, not just rinsing the visible portion.
Before starting any job we walk the property to identify anything that needs extra care, such as delicate plants near the foundation, older or already-damaged siding, or surfaces that have been recently painted or sealed. That walkthrough shapes how we approach the work rather than applying the same method everywhere regardless of condition.

Protecting your property while we work
Water and cleaning solution can travel further than people expect, so we take steps to keep them where they belong. That includes covering or moving outdoor furniture, protecting garden beds and landscaping from runoff, and being mindful of electrical outlets, light fixtures and other features on the exterior of a home. On Christmas light installation jobs, we are careful with rooflines, gutters and existing exterior fixtures so nothing is damaged during install or takedown.
We also pay attention to the small things that leave a property looking untouched by the process itself: closing gates behind us, moving anything we had to shift back into place, and giving the work area a final look before we consider a job complete.

How we keep quality consistent
Consistency on an exterior job comes down to process rather than luck. We work the same order of operations on every property, starting from the top and working down so that rinse water and loosened debris never fall onto something we have already finished. Gutters and rooflines come before siding, siding comes before windows, and hard surfaces like driveways and walkways are cleaned last so the finished result is the last thing you see.
Before we leave, we walk the property with the same short checklist every time: glass checked in daylight from a few angles, tracks and sills wiped, downspouts confirmed flowing, plants and furniture put back where they started, and hoses and cords cleared off walkways. If something needs a second pass, we would rather catch it ourselves than have you find it after we have driven away.
We also keep notes on the properties we return to, including access details, which windows are painted shut, where the water spigot is, and which surfaces needed extra attention last time. Repeat visits go faster and turn out better when we are not rediscovering the same details every season.
